Our Process
Once printed all of our models are thoroughly washed using Iso-Propyl Alcohol to remove all uncured resins. After they have all had their little bath all supports are carefully removed and then put through a final curing process.Â
After final curing, the manufacturing process is complete. The models are then put through Quality Assurance.
Quality Assurance
All models go through a comprehensive quality assurance check. We are looking for any lost detail, poor printing, missing parts or damages. We also test fit multi-part models to ensure that all gaps are as minimal as possible, including how a base sits on the table. Â
During this process you may find there are small sanded points to ensure a good fit or for bases that they are level and flat.
